Branch: refs/heads/master
Home:
https://github.com/Checkmk/checkmk
Commit: d6da17ee55e9e1984b870044f6dffe7aee6b28bb
https://github.com/Checkmk/checkmk/commit/d6da17ee55e9e1984b870044f6dffe7ae…
Author: Sergey Kipnis <sergey.kipnis(a)checkmk.com>
Date: 2024-01-04 (Thu, 04 Jan 2024)
Changed paths:
M packages/check-sql/src/args.rs
M packages/check-sql/src/constants.rs
M packages/check-sql/src/setup.rs
Log Message:
-----------
check-sql: improve logging
- default size of file is 500K
- tiberius level is set to warn
Change-Id: Ic80884cf429c8e19c3d3eea19a1a73b29b09c2dd
Commit: a0f9cfc2666d654aa579c0005c6f195756ff3434
https://github.com/Checkmk/checkmk/commit/a0f9cfc2666d654aa579c0005c6f19575…
Author: Sergey Kipnis <sergey.kipnis(a)checkmk.com>
Date: 2024-01-04 (Thu, 04 Jan 2024)
Changed paths:
M packages/check-sql/tests/test_ms_sql.rs
Log Message:
-----------
check-sql: improve logging in tests
Change-Id: I2c546132b6a3225416702bbf5fb29f21e84d524a
Commit: a24c872019c4cfd81c3df28d231e8054a00c3cf2
https://github.com/Checkmk/checkmk/commit/a24c872019c4cfd81c3df28d231e8054a…
Author: Sergey Kipnis <sergey.kipnis(a)checkmk.com>
Date: 2024-01-04 (Thu, 04 Jan 2024)
Changed paths:
M packages/check-sql/src/args.rs
M packages/check-sql/src/config/ms_sql.rs
M packages/check-sql/src/config/section.rs
M packages/check-sql/src/config/system.rs
M packages/check-sql/src/config/yaml.rs
M packages/check-sql/src/constants.rs
M packages/check-sql/src/setup.rs
M packages/check-sql/src/utils.rs
Log Message:
-----------
check-sql: introduce new logging config support
Logging configuration including defaults is now fully inside
config::Logging struct.
No Some option -> store None.
Side effects:
- get_int with forced default replaced with get_int returning Option,
- read_file is moved to utils(due to shared usage)
- Args api chenged to unify string generation for flexi_logger::parse
Change-Id: I3a71463dc513a734b395ead6687a19825515a589
Compare:
https://github.com/Checkmk/checkmk/compare/d5b97444a715...a24c872019c4